The tariff classification of a diaper caddy from China

Issued November 29, 2006 by U.S. Customs and Border Protection.

Tariff classification

HTS codes: 6307.90.9889

Headings: 6307

Product description

The submitted sample is identified as a diaper caddy. The open-top item is constructed of heavy woven fabric and measures approximately 9”W x 9¼”D x 7½”H. It features open exterior pockets on three sides and fabric carrying handles located on two of the opposite exterior sides of the caddy. It is apparently for home use only and not for travel or transport as it has no means of closure and no convenient form of carrying handles.

CBP rationale

The applicable subheading for the diaper caddy will be 6307.90.9889,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TSUS), which provides for other made up textile articles, other.
